Transaction 50500070b135ba4a2810e66ad4e2af4fc88dfb341eb4be48fe373bc642a8ab45
1 Input
2 Outputs
- 50500070b135ba4a2810e66ad4e2af4fc88dfb341eb4be48fe373bc642a8ab45:0
- 50500070b135ba4a2810e66ad4e2af4fc88dfb341eb4be48fe373bc642a8ab45:1
value 2276976120
address 18wsmLWRNfWgEkB23Vqan1NzP4VmaPy1QC
value 986193
address 1HDmw4ZK5kMh7uwDdMZoxkzW1D8DoBMzVz